Return Of The Jedi Action Figures
Star Wars action figures based on The Return Of The Jedi were first released in 1983. Decades later, action figures and toys based on the 3rd Star Wars movie are still being produced, and Star Wars as a franchise is as popular as it ever was.
Return of the Jedi's theatrical release took place on May 25, 1983. It was originally slated to be May 27, but was subsequently changed to coincide with the date of the 1977 release of Star Wars: A New Hope.
With a massive worldwide marketing campaign, illustrator Tim Reamer created the iconic and distinctive image for the movie poster and other advertising. At the time of its release, the film was advertised simply as Star Wars: Return of the Jedi, despite its on-screen "Episode VI" distinction. This was evident on release posters and merchandise. The film grossed more than $475 million worldwide.
